Abstract
Application of the Hammerstein Block-oriented Exact Solution Technique (H-BEST) to a real industrial process is presented. The methodology is extended to processes with a Wiener structure, and named the Wiener block-Oriented Exact Solution Technique (W-BEST). The W-BEST methodology is presented in detail and applied to a simulated continuous-stirred tank reactor with complex dynamic behavior. W-BEST is then compared to another continuous-time Wiener-based model found in the literature and applied to an example process. The results of the two methods are compared using a test input sequence applied to the example process.
